Shanghai Airlines suspends Shanghai-Budapest direct service

Shanghai Airlines has suspended its Shanghai-Budapest direct flight, the company that runs Budapest Liszt Ferenc International Airport said on Monday.
The suspension affects flights operated with a Boeing 787 aircraft between Feb. 10 and March 31,
Budapest Airport said in a statement.
The airline last week suspended two indirect services between Shanghai and Budapest, one with a stopover in Xi’an and the other in Chengdu until late March, details HERE.
Another airline, Hainan, said on Saturday that it has suspended its Chongqing-Budapest direct service until March 28.
The only airline that still operates services between Hungary and China is Air China,
with three flights a week between Beijing and Budapest and a stopover in Minsk.
Budapest Airport said it is coordinating with Chinese airlines operating direct flights between the two countries and European airlines with transfer options to destinations in China with a view to ensuring safe services.
Passengers with a ticket are advised to contact the airline about the option of re-booking or receiving a refund.
